**Alert: Slabdiff rendering degradation on files over 500MB**

Plugin authors consuming the Slabdiff viewport API may see delayed hunk callbacks when diffing very large files. This is caused by backpressure in the chunk scheduler and does not indicate data loss. Callbacks will fire once the scheduler drains. Workarounds and affected API versions are documented on the status page below.

wiki page, tahaf-tajog: https://jira.ordindyn.corp/pipeline

// Maximum AST depth for user-supplied formulas in Tallygrove.
// Anything deeper is rejected before evaluation to prevent
// stack exhaustion inside the Hollowbox sandbox. Do not raise
// this without re-running the recursion fuzz suite, as the
// sandbox's memory ceiling was tuned against this exact limit.
// The sandbox build this limit was validated against follows.

session token of kafof-kafop = htk31_c3becf8b8eac3ed970037fba36e258e

Subject: Safe lock replacement — pick-up tomorrow

Hi dispatch,

Quick one: the replacement lock assembly for the big safe in the Pellworth office finally arrived from Bramley Security Works. It's boxed up on shelf 3 by the cage, marked fragile. Needs to go out tomorrow morning so the fitter can do the install before noon. Keep it off the general manifest, please. The courier hand-over instruction for this item is given below.

courier memo of fadug-tajop: the gorir sorael courier leaves the istys ledger at gate 1509 under passcode 497843

Handover — night shift, Velmora House. Dayside pulled all Trellick DS-40 door sensors per the recall notice from Cardelo Systems. Units on floors 2–4 are disconnected; doors there fail secure, so use manual keys from the duty cabinet. Replacement sensors arrive Thursday. Log any stuck latches in the fault book, don't reset panels yourself. The temporary contractor door on the east stairwell still needs the override to open.

door code, bagef-yafop: bdg-ZFZML-07646

TICKET-4471: Vault locked — TimeGrid Solver plugin secrets. The Chalkline vault sealed itself after three failed unseal attempts during the periods-per-week migration. Plugin authors cannot fetch signing tokens until it's reopened. Ops rotated the unseal shares this morning. Use the recovery passphrase below to restore plugin credential access.

unlock words, hahip-baduf: holwyn-istath-julvan